Latest Patents: McQuade's patent focuses on a "Logical Clock Connection in an Integrated Circuit Design." This invention involves a first plurality of hardware description language (HDL) files that describe a hierarchical integrated circuit design. What sets this design apart is its simplified HDL syntax, which omits the specification of logical clock connections for some entities in the hierarchical structure. Through an innovative processing method, this design allows for the automatic addition of logical clock connections where necessary. As a result, a second plurality of HDL files is generated to define the hierarchical integrated circuit design comprehensively.
